Transaction 901a8825f340600f3d97387ab6347d6319a53d2f06c05e7cbc7e260b52c9ec9e

1 Input
2 Outputs
  • 901a8825f340600f3d97387ab6347d6319a53d2f06c05e7cbc7e260b52c9ec9e:0
  • value  33820474
    address  3H19uMnhmBgfWgfi2b6EaTBaPqio6dVVka
  • 901a8825f340600f3d97387ab6347d6319a53d2f06c05e7cbc7e260b52c9ec9e:1
  • value  49009928447
    address  3FA1aEUy7NSYr49KXJe1HLWAKcQhr9Umju